Eisenbahn-Denkmal, a captivating historical landmark in Reykjavik, offers tourists a glimpse into Iceland's unique railway heritage. As you explore this site, you'll discover the stories of a bygone era when trains were a rare sight on the island. This monument is not just a tribute to the past but also a picturesque spot for photographs and reflection, making it a must-visit for history enthusiasts and casual travelers alike.

Getting There
-
Car
If you're driving from the center of Reykjavík, start on Laugavegur street heading east. Continue straight until you reach the intersection with Geirsgata. Turn right onto Geirsgata, and continue for about 300 meters. You will find the Eisenbahn-Denkmal at coordinates 64.1493384, -21.9378968, which is a short walk from the road. Parking may be available nearby, but be sure to check local parking regulations.
-
Public Transportation
To reach Eisenbahn-Denkmal via public transportation, take Bus Line 1 from the central bus station (BSÍ). Disembark at the 'Hlemmur' stop. From there, you can either walk approximately 15 minutes towards Geirsgata by heading southeast on Laugavegur, then turning right onto Geirsgata. Alternatively, you can catch Bus Line 6 from Hlemmur towards 'Sundlaug' and get off at 'Geirsgata' stop, which is closer to the monument.
